Why Seasonal Ingredients Matter
Eating seasonally isn’t just about taste; it’s also about nutrition and sustainability. Fruits and vegetables harvested at their peak ripeness are often more nutrient-dense than those shipped long distances. Plus, when you choose locally grown produce, you're supporting local farmers and reducing your carbon footprint. It’s a win-win situation.
In summer, fruits like berries, peaches, and melons come into their prime. Vegetables like cucumbers, tomatoes, and peppers are also abundant. All these ingredients offer various v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ants that can boost your health while tantalizing your taste buds.
Fresh Fruit Skewers
One of the simplest yet most enjoyable snacks you can prepare is fresh fruit skewers. These colorful creations are not only visually appealing but also super easy to make. Start by gathering an assortment of seasonal fruits such as strawberries, blueberries, watermelon cubes, and peach slices. Thread them onto wooden skewers in any order you like.
For an added twist, consider drizzling a little honey or yogurt over the skewers before serving. You could even sprinkle some toasted coconut or crushed nuts for texture. This snack is perfect for gatherings or as a fun treat for kids on hot days.
Veggie Dips with Seasonal Produce
Another fantastic way to incorporate seasonal ingredients is through veggie dips using fresh produce. Think beyond basic carrots and celery; summer offers a treasure trove of options. Slice up cucumbers into rounds or sticks—these are incredibly refreshing in warm weather. Bell peppers add crunch and sweetness while zucchini rounds provide a unique twist.
Pair these veggies with homemade dips featuring seasonal herbs like basil or dill. A simple yogurt dip flavored with garlic and lemon juice can be both delicious and nutritious. Mixing in chopped herbs creates an extra layer of flavor that elevates your dipping experience.

Energy Bites Packed with Flavor
Energy bites have surged in popularity as quick snacks loaded with nutrients to keep your energy levels up throughout the day. They’re especially great for those busy summer afternoons when you need something substantial yet light.
Start with oats as your base ingredient—these provide complex carbohydrates for sustained energy. Add nut butter for healthy fats along with honey or maple syrup for sweetness. Incorporate chopped dried fruits like apricots or dates for natural sugars along with seeds such as chia or flax for additional omega-3s.
Once mixed together, roll small amounts into bite-sized balls and refrigerate them until firm. These convenient snacks are perfect for grabbing on the go after a morning hike or during beach outings.
Grilled Veggie Wraps
If you’re seeking something more savory to nibble on during summer days, grilled veggie wraps could become your go-to option. Choose vegetables that grill well—zucchini slices, bell pepper strips, asparagus spears—and toss them lightly in olive oil with salt and pepper before grilling them until tender.
Wrap these grilled beauties in whole wheat tortillas along with some fresh spinach leaves or arugula for added nutrients. You might add hummus or tzatziki sauce inside for extra flavor without sacrificing health benefits.
Not only do these wraps make excellent finger foods at parties but they’re also portable enough to take along on picnics—or enjoy them at home while watching your favorite summer movie under the stars.
Frozen Banana Pops
For an indulgent yet healthy dessert option that kids (and adults) will love during hot days ahead—frozen banana pops fit the bill perfectly! Simply slice bananas into thick rounds before inserting popsicle sticks into each piece.
Dip these banana rounds into melted dark chocolate (which contains antioxidants) followed by rolling them in crushed nuts or shredded coconut if desired before placing them on parchment paper-lined trays ready to freeze until solid.
These treats are not only fun to make but also offer satisfying textures from both creamy banana interiors alongside crunchy coatings—all while being rich in potassium!
